Richland, MO has a humid continental climate with four distinct seasons. Summers are usually warm and humid with temperatures reaching up to 90 degrees Fahrenheit. Winters are cold and dry with temperatures dropping down to an average of 25 degrees Fahrenheit. Rainfall is spread out evenly throughout the year, with spring and fall being the wettest seasons due to intense thunderstorms that occur in the area. Richland experiences a good amount of sunshine all year round, with about 15 hours of daylight in the summer months and 8 hours in winter.
Richland (zip 65556), Missouri gets 46 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38 inches of rain per year.
Richland (zip 65556) averages 11 inches of snow per year. The US average is 28 inches of snow per year.
On average, there are 199 sunny days per year in Richland (zip 65556). The US average is 205 sunny days.
Richland (zip 65556) gets some kind of precipitation, on average, 94 days per year. Precipitation is rain, snow, sleet, or hail that falls to the ground. In order for precipitation to be counted you have to get at least .01 inches on the ground to measure.
